Biological Background: CD138/Syndecan-1 Function and Localization

  • Syndecan-1 (CD138) is a cell surface proteoglycan that contains both heparan sulfate and chondroitin sulfate chains, linking the cytoskeleton to the interstitial matrix.
  • It regulates exosome biogenesis in concert with SDCBP and PDCD6IP. Related references: PMID:22660413
  • Syndecan-1 can induce its own expression in dental mesenchymal cells and neighboring dental epithelial cells via an MSX1-mediated pathway.
  • The protein is detected in placenta and fibroblasts at the protein level, indicating tissue-specific expression patterns.
  • Subcellularly, syndecan-1 localizes to the cell membrane, is secreted, and is found in extracellular exosomes.
  • Post-translational modifications include glycosylation with heparan sulfate and chondroitin sulfate, as well as phosphorylation, contributing to its functional diversity.
